Problema de renderização de imagens sob CSS personalizado

Dando seguimento ao tópico abaixo (eu teria continuado lá, mas esse tópico agora está fechado):

A renderização de um arquivo de imagem com estilo CSS personalizado parece ter um pequeno bug — a saber, a borda sólida preta de 1px do lado direito não é exibida. Reduzir a imagem para 95% corrige o problema. O CSS personalizado é border : 1px solid black. A pré-visualização da edição renderiza corretamente — mas a versão ao vivo não. Um exemplo pode ser encontrado aqui. Como eu disse, este é um pequeno bug, mas provavelmente vale a pena corrigir. Agradeço antecipadamente.

Eu posso evitar esse problema definindo também width : 98%, mas não acho que eu deveria ter que fazer isso? Alguma opinião?

Parece que basta usar box-sizing para fazer com que a largura automática leve em conta a borda.

.cooked img:not(.thumbnail, .ytp-thumbnail-image, .emoji), .d-editor-preview img:not(.thumbnail, .ytp-thumbnail-image, .emoji) {
  border: 1px solid #000;
  box-sizing: border-box;
}

@Alteras Funciona. Uma salva de palmas rápida!

@ administradores: talvez o código nesta postagem possa ser devidamente modificado (ou isso é contra os protocolos):

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.